Warning Signs You Need Wood Trim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and health risks. Here are some common signs that show you need wood trim water damage restoration: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ong musty odors are a sign of water damage. If you notice a persistent smell, it’s essential to address the issue before it spreads.

Warped or Discolored Wood Trim

Warped or discolored wood trim is a clear indication of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your wood trim, don’t hesitate to contact us.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on ceilings or walls can be a sign of a larger issue. Don’t ignore these stains, they can lead to further damage and health risks.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your walls, contact us immediately.

Unpleasant Sounds or Creaks

Unpleasant sounds or creaks can show water damage. If you notice any unusual noises, it’s essential to investigate further.

Visible Signs of Leaks

Visible signs of leaks are a clear indication of water damage. If you notice any water spots or leaks, contact us immediately.

Wood Trim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ill on wood trim Yes No You can clean up the spill yourself and prevent further damage.
Visible signs of warping or discoloration No Yes A professional assessment is necessary to find out the extent of the damage.
Musty odors or water stains No Yes Ignoring these signs can lead to further damage and health risks.
Large water spill or flood No Yes A professional team is necessary to contain and restore the damage.
Water damage on load-bearing walls No Yes Professional assessment and repair are necessary to ensure structural integrity.
Water damage on ceilings or floors No Yes A professional team is necessary to prevent further damage and health risks.

Wood Trim Water Damage Restoration Cost in Picacho, AZ

The cost of wood trim water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Picacho, AZ. Our team provides free estimates and works with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$200-$500 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Drying and Dehumidification $500-$2,000 Size of affected area and local conditions
Wood Trim Repair and Replacement $1,000-$5,000 Size of affected area and type of wood trim
Cleaning and Disinfecting $200-$1,000 Size of affected area and type of cleaning products used
Final Inspection and Quality Control $100-$500 Size of affected area and complexity of the job
